How do you add 1/3 + 5/12 + 4/5?

1/3+5/12+4/5=1 11/20

Explanation:

To add 1/3+5/12+4/5, firs convert all denominators to Lease Common Denominator (LCD), which is nothing but Least common multiple of 3, 12 and 5. As 3 is a factor of 12, their LCD is 12 and LCD of 12 and 5 is 12xx5=60 (as nothing is common between them. Hence LCD of 3, 12 and 5 is 60.

Hence, converting each denominator of 1/3+5/12+4/5 to LCD,

1/3+5/12+4/5 = (1xx20)/(3xx20)+(5xx5)/(12xx5)+(4xx12)/(5xx12)

= 20/60+25/60+48/60

= (20+25+48)/60=93/60=(31cancel93)/(20cancel60)=31/20=1 11/20

(We have divided 93 and 60 by 3 here to simplify.)
